After learning this subject you will be able to....
 

---Identify and describe reactivity patterns in organic reaction.

---Explain theoretical principles underlying molecular structure, bonding and properties

---Describe the importance and relevance of Hard and soft materials and also their characterization, properties and uses in engineering applications.

---Distinguish the difference between the different orders of reaction and apply accordingly.

---Utilize different thermo-dynamical laws to explain course of reactions.

---Apply the different spectroscopic techniques to explain the inner &surface characteristic of molecules.

Experiments to be performed
Sr. No.
Title
1
To determine melting point of given sample. LINK-1    LINK-2
2
To determine boiling point of given sample.  LINK-1    LINK-2
3
To determine hardness of given water sample. Link-1    Link-2
4
To determine the alkalinity in given water sample. Link -1   Link-2
5
To determine the amount of chloride content in given water sample using Mohr’s method.  Link 1(Residual Cl)   Link-2   Link - 3
6
To determine the moisture content in coal.   Link 1 LOD Method   Link-2
7
Determination of Concentration of Unknown Solution Spectrophotometrically.    Link 1   Link-2  Link-3
8
Determination of Saponification Value of Oil.  Link 1   Link-2 Link-3
